Electric water heater repair services address issues related to the malfunction or failure of electric water heating units commonly found in residential properties. These projects typically involve diagnosing problems such as insufficient hot water, strange noises, leaks, or complete unit failure, and then performing necessary repairs to restore proper function. Homeowners often seek these services when their electric water heater is not heating water effectively, making strange sounds, or exhibiting signs of corrosion or leaks that could lead to further damage if left unaddressed.
Before requesting electric water heater rep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of potential repairs, the expected lifespan of their unit, and whether repairs are a cost-effective alternative to replacement. It’s also important to consider the age of the water heater, as older units may be more prone to recurring issues. Clear communication about the problem symptoms and any previous maintenance can help ensure a thorough diagnosis and efficient service.

Common Electric Water Heater Repair Jobs
Electric Water Heater Repair - restores hot water supply by fixing electrical components and thermostats.
Tank Replacement - replaces faulty or aging water heater tanks to ensure reliable hot water.
Thermostat Troubleshooting - identifies and repairs thermostat issues that affect water temperature.
Leak Repairs - addresses leaks caused by corrosion, faulty valves, or tank damage.
Electrical System Checks - inspects wiring and connections for safety and proper operation.
Scheduled Maintenance - performs routine inspections to prevent future breakdowns and extend unit lifespan.
Electric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s of a malfunctioning electric water heater? Signs include inconsistent water temperature, strange noises, or leaks around the unit.
Can a broken thermostat cause water temperature issues? Yes, a faulty thermostat can lead to water that is too hot or not hot enough.
Is it possible to repair a water heater that has stopped producing hot water? Yes, many issues can be resolved through repairs such as replacing heating elements or thermostats.
What should property owners know about electric water heater maintenance? Regular inspections can help identify problems early and ensure efficient operation.
